Kin-Dza-Dza! Blu-ray presents one of the most singular science fiction films ever produced, a deadpan cosmic satire that transforms existential despair into surreal comedy. Directed by Georgiy Daneliya, this cult Soviet classic imagines a universe where logic has collapsed, language has been reduced to nonsense syllables, and social hierarchy is enforced through the colour of one’s trousers.

 

When two ordinary Muscovites — a blunt construction foreman and a Georgian violin student — encounter a strange homeless man asking about their planet’s number in the “Tentura,” they are instantly transported across the galaxy to the desert planet Pluke. There, wooden matches are priceless currency, society is ruled by arbitrary customs, and communication consists largely of the words “ku” and “kyu.” What follows is a bleakly hilarious journey through an alien civilization that feels disturbingly familiar.

 

Often described as Andrei Tarkovsky colliding with Douglas Adams, Kin-Dza-Dza! blends absurdist humour with biting political satire, skewering bureaucracy, class systems, and institutional stupidity across all ideologies and planets. Its strange imagery — balloon-marked graves, collapsed ferris wheels as housing, and barter-based social codes — builds a universe that is simultaneously ridiculous and unsettling.
